Exporters must comply with Malaysian export control regulations, including licensing for strategic goods and restricted commodities.
All imports are subject to Brazilian customs clearance through Siscomex and may require import licenses (LI) for controlled items.

When shipping from Port Klang, Malaysia to Salvador, Brazil, anticipate significant delays due to the Southeast Asia Monsoon Season (May-November) and Brazil's Wet Season (October-March). Add extra buffer days to schedules to accommodate port congestion and draft restrictions. Confirm vessel space and equipment well in advance, especially during peak harvest periods (February-September) and holiday seasons (late December-early January). Coordinate closely with carriers for real-time updates, as localized flooding can impact transit times and delivery commitments.

When shipping a television, pack in an upright TV carton with foam edge and corner protectors, wrap the screen in foam wrap, and brace all voids so the unit cannot move. Transport the TV standing upright, label the box with “This Side Up” and “Fragile – Electronics,” and Avoid exposure to rain or damp areas since the internal Electronics are moisture sensitive.
Yes, home theater components needs rigid cartons with dense foam or molded inserts that support the chassis, not the knobs or connectors. Pack each amplifier individually, bundle accessories in separate bags, and include desiccant packs for moisture control. For multiple units, place on pallets with corner posts and stretch wrap to keep the load stable.
International shipments of electronic devices typically involve a commercial invoice, packing list, and all applicable export declarations. Clearly state product descriptions, HS codes, serial numbers for high-value TVs, and the true transaction value to avoid delays at customs. For certain AV equipment, Check if additional certifications or licenses are needed in the destination country.
For moisture-sensitive gadgets, pack with moisture-barrier bags or sealed poly bags around each unit, include desiccant sachets inside the inner packaging, and close cartons tightly. On pallets of audio equipment, use stretch film and, where possible, Add pallet covers to shield against condensation or light rain during handling.
Because electronic devices like high-end audio equipment are high value and fragile, adding cargo insurance that matches their replacement cost is strongly recommended. Verify your carrier’s standard liability limits, list accurate values and serial numbers, and retain packing photos and invoices so any claim for damaged Gadgets can be processed efficiently.
Consumer electronics are sensitive to temperature and humidity fluctuations, so it is essential to use climate-controlled containers during ocean freight. Additionally, proper packaging to prevent physical damage and secure loading to avoid movement during transit is crucial.
Required documentation includes a commercial invoice, packing list, bill of lading, and any necessary import permits or certifications to comply with Brazilian regulations on electronic devices. It is important to ensure all paperwork is accurate to facilitate customs clearance.
